850544-26-2 - Physico-chemical Properties
Molecular Formula | C6H2Cl2N2O4
|
Molar Mass | 237 |
Density | 1.810±0.06 g/cm3(Predicted) |
Melting Point | 137-139 °C |
Boling Point | 421.1±45.0 °C(Predicted) |
pKa | 1.97±0.13(Predicted) |
